How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Alorton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Alorton Studio Apartments | $1,239 | $642 | $1,990 |
| Alorton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,489 | $386 | $3,927 |
| Alorton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,002 | $440 | $7,935 |
| Alorton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,175 | $962 | $6,150 |
| Alorton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,750 | $3,650 | $3,850 |

Largest Available Alorton and Nearby Studio Apartments
The largest available Studio apartment unit in Alorton, IL is found at Gallery 720 in the Lafayette Square neighborhood and is 630 square feet priced from $1,120. Williamsburg Apartments in the Belleville neighborhood has the second largest Studio, which is sized at 550 square feet and currently listed start at $642. Here is today’s list of the largest available Studio units in Alorton: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gallery 720 | Studios | 630 Sq Ft | $1,120 |
| Williamsburg Apartments | Studio | 550 Sq Ft | $642 |
| The Shelby | Papin | 543 Sq Ft | $965 |
| The Gentrys Landing Apartments | Studio Unfurnished | 500 Sq Ft | $855 |
| 11th and Spruce | 0x1-The Clark | 485 Sq Ft | $1,167 |
Cheapest Available Alorton and Nearby Studio Apartments
As of September 14, 2026 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Alorton, IL is the Studio Model starting from $642 at Williamsburg Apartments in the Belleville neighborhood. The second most affordable Alorton Studio is the Studio Model at Downtowner Apartments starting at $775 in the Lafayette Square neighborhood. The average price for all Studio apartments in Alorton is currently $1,239.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in Alorton: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Williamsburg Apartments | Studio | $642 |
| Downtowner Apartments | Studio | $775 |
| The Gentrys Landing Apartments | Studio Unfurnished | $855 |
| The Shelby | Papin | $965 |
| Gallery 720 | Studios | $1,120 |
